I'm always delighted to add to my Finnish vaseline glass collection.
I did some reading on Tamara Aladin. She was the most prolific, yet the least recognized of the three badass lady designers working at Rihimäen Lasi during the 50s and 60s. Nanny Still and Helena Tynell were the other squad members. I love the mid-century designs they made.
